### Runbook: Recovering the Lintgrove Baseline File

So you've nuked the static-analysis baseline again. Happens to everyone. Lintgrove keeps a signed copy of `baseline.lock` in the recovery bucket, but the CI bot's account is probably the thing that's locked out (that's usually why you're here). Run `lintgrove restore --from-archive` and it'll prompt for account recovery. Don't regenerate the baseline from scratch — you'll bless 400 existing warnings and Marit will haunt you. The recovery prompt accepts the passphrase below.

strongbox words: briiel-zoreth-noveth-pelys-druwyn-feniel-lamvan-ulaius-kasion

- [ ] Step 7: Archive cold storage buckets (Glacierline tier). Confirm both ceremony witnesses are present, verify bucket manifests match the Oxbow ledger, then seal the archive key shares. Plugin authors may observe but not handle shares. Once sealed, the archive index itself is encrypted and can only be reopened with the passphrase below.

vault phrase of badup-hahig = tamael-aldael-kelmir-istael-fenok-istwyn-tamius-jorath-oliion

- [ ] **Step 7: Breaker override escrow.** After sealing the signing keys for the Tallgrove upstream API circuit breaker, confirm the support team can force the breaker open during a full outage. The override bundle lives in the sealed escrow drawer and is useless without its unlock phrase. Two ceremony witnesses must initial this step before proceeding. The escrow bundle is decrypted with the recovery passphrase that follows.

vault phrase of kahip-kahop = holath-quenmir

Ticket #PAYX-armature — Vault locked after payroll export format change

While migrating the Thistlebrook payroll export from fixed-width to the new columnar format, the Coldharbor vault auto-locked mid-rotation and rejected the service credentials. Please review the attached diff carefully: the serializer change is isolated, but the vault unlock path now requires manual intervention. To reopen it for the next export run, use the recovery passphrase noted directly below this line.

unlock words, kajef-tawif: eliael-casael